AMC BA Philosophy FAQs
Ques. What is the total fee for BA Philosophy at Ananda Mohan College, Kolkata?
Ans. The total fee for the 3-year BA Philosophy Honours programme at Ananda Mohan College is INR 11,760 for the complete course, covering all three years of study. This makes it one of the most affordable Honours-level programmes available under the University of Calcutta in Kolkata. The fee is payable in instalments as directed during the online admission process via WBCAP.
Ques. How is admission to BA Philosophy done at Ananda Mohan College in 2026?
Ans. Admission to BA Philosophy at Ananda Mohan College is through the West Bengal Centralised Admission Portal (WBCAP) at wbcap.in. Candidates apply using their CUET-UG score or Class 12 aggregate marks. Merit lists are released by WBCAP and shortlisted candidates complete online admission, followed by physical document submission at the college in person within the deadline set by WBCAP.
Ques. Is the BA Philosophy degree from Ananda Mohan College recognised by the University of Calcutta?
Ans. Yes. Ananda Mohan College is affiliated with the University of Calcutta, and the BA Philosophy Honours degree awarded after successful completion of the 3-year programme is a University of Calcutta degree. It is fully recognised across India for admission to postgraduate programmes, government competitive examinations, teacher training, and public sector recruitment.
Ques. What career paths are open to BA Philosophy graduates from Ananda Mohan College?
Ans. Graduates of BA Philosophy from Ananda Mohan College can pursue MA Philosophy at Calcutta University or other institutions, civil services examinations at state and central levels, B.Ed teacher training programmes, or law school. The critical thinking and analytical skills developed through the Philosophy Honours curriculum are also valued in competitive examinations, public administration, social research, and editorial careers.
Ques. Are government scholarships available for BA Philosophy students at AMC Kolkata?
Ans. Yes. Students enrolled at Ananda Mohan College can apply for the Swami Vivekananda Merit Cum Means Scholarship of INR 12,000 per year for Arts students from West Bengal with family income below INR 2.5 lakh. The Kanyasree Prakalpa is available for eligible unmarried female students below 19 years, and the Aikyasree Scholarship supports meritorious minority students. All applications are submitted through the West Bengal e-District portal or the National Scholarship Portal within the notified deadlines.
